Medical displays are used in medical-grade monitors, including mammography, tomosynthesis, and picture archiving and communication systems (PACS), to address medical imaging needs like endoscopy, x-ray, ultrasound, or sectional. These displays usually come with advanced image-enhancing technologies to ensure consistent brightness over the lifetime of the display, noise-free images, ergonomic reading, and automated compliance with medical standards. At present, they are preferred over consumer displays around the world to meet set requirements for image quality, medical regulations, and quality assurance.
Medical Display Market Trends:
The rising prevalence of new diseases is resulting in increasing morbidity and mortality rates. This is escalating the need for advanced diagnostic modalities, which represents one of the key factors driving the market. Moreover, the increasing geriatric population, which is more prone to chronic illnesses, is influencing the market positively across the globe. Besides this, the responsive touch feature in medical displays, when combined with antimicrobial touch glass, prevents the risk of cross-contamination between healthcare professionals and patients. This, in confluence with the increasing cases of infectious diseases, is contributing to the market growth. Furthermore, the growing adoption of personalized treatment options and point of care (POC) testing is creating a favorable outlook for the market. Apart from this, several manufacturers are introducing 4K ultra high definition (HD) displays with a wide range of picture formats and interfaces for surgical and general clinical applications. In addition, they are focusing on expanding their portfolio of monitors that offer enhanced patient and staff safety and detailed visualization to support improved outcomes. Such innovations are anticipated to provide a thrust to the growth of the market in the coming years.
